RV & Harmonic Gearboxes for Industrial Robots

High‑precision RV cycloidal and harmonic strain wave gearboxes for 6‑axis articulated robots and collaborative robot joints. Zero‑backlash performance, high torsional rigidity, and compact design enable accurate path following and high repeatability.

High‑Speed Linear Guides & Ball Screws

Precision linear motion components for Cartesian gantry robots, pick‑and‑place systems, and CNC machine tools. Hardened and ground profile rails with high‑load ball bearing carriages. Preloaded ball screws with C3–C5 accuracy for positioning applications.

Precision Motion Validation & Cleanroom Capabilities

AIMRSE supports automation OEMs with advanced testing and manufacturing processes that ensure components meet the exacting demands of high‑speed, high‑precision motion control. Our ISO 14644 cleanroom assembly and advanced metrology ensure reliable performance in semiconductor, medical, and electronics manufacturing applications.

  • ISO 14644 Class 7 Cleanroom Assembly
    Precision robot gearboxes and linear guides are assembled and lubricated in a controlled cleanroom environment. This minimizes particulate contamination and ensures long‑term reliability in semiconductor and flat‑panel display manufacturing equipment.
  • Coordinate Measuring Machine (CMM) & Laser Interferometry
    We verify dimensional accuracy and positioning repeatability using Zeiss CMMs and Renishaw laser interferometers. Full geometric and positional data is available for PPAP and machine builder qualification.
  • Life Cycle & Backlash Test Stands
    Dedicated test rigs for RV and harmonic gearboxes perform accelerated life testing under simulated robot duty cycles. Backlash and torsional rigidity are monitored throughout the test to validate performance retention.
  • Linear Guide Preload & Friction Measurement
    We measure dynamic friction and preload of every linear guide assembly to ensure consistent motion characteristics across production batches. Data is correlated with customer‑specified motor sizing parameters.

Featured Industrial Automation Application Case

The Challenge

Positional Drift and Excessive Backlash in Collaborative Robot Wrist Joint

A cobot manufacturer observed gradual positional drift and path inaccuracy in the wrist joint of their 5 kg payload collaborative robot after approximately 3,000 hours of operation. Teardown analysis revealed accelerated wear in the harmonic gearbox flexspline due to marginal lubrication distribution under continuous reversing duty cycles. The backlash had increased from the specified 0.5 arc‑min to over 3 arc‑min, impacting teach‑and‑repeat positioning.

The Solution: Lubrication Optimization and Gearbox Life Validation

AIMRSE worked with the gearbox manufacturer to specify a higher‑viscosity, fully synthetic grease with improved channeling characteristics for the harmonic drive. A revised lubrication fill volume and break‑in procedure were developed to ensure full tooth contact under reversing loads. Accelerated life testing on our dedicated gearbox rig validated the new lubrication protocol, confirming less than 0.5 arc‑min backlash increase after 10,000 equivalent operating hours.

Validated Path Accuracy Retention and Extended Service Life

3x Extension in Maintenance Interval

Field retrofits of the optimized lubrication protocol eliminated premature wrist joint replacements. The recommended relubrication interval was extended from 5,000 to 15,000 operating hours, reducing total cost of ownership and improving customer uptime. Path accuracy per ISO 9283 remained within specification throughout the extended interval.

Frequently Asked Questions — Automation & Robotics

What is the backlash specification for your RV and harmonic gearboxes?
Standard RV gearboxes offer <1 arc‑min backlash, with precision grades achieving <0.5 arc‑min. Harmonic drive gearboxes typically provide <0.5 arc‑min backlash. All gearboxes are supplied with individual measurement reports documenting actual backlash and torsional rigidity.
Do you offer linear guides with cleanroom‑compatible lubrication?
Yes. We offer linear guides and ball screws with cleanroom‑compatible greases that meet ISO 14644 Class 1–5 requirements for low outgassing and minimal particulate generation. Vacuum‑compatible options are also available for semiconductor and aerospace applications.
Can you provide integrated servo motor and gearbox packages?
Absolutely. We offer complete motion axis packages including precision gearboxes (planetary, RV, harmonic) pre‑mounted and aligned with servo motors from major manufacturers. This simplifies integration and ensures optimal motor‑gearbox performance.
What is the accuracy grade of your ball screws?
Standard ball screws are supplied to C5 accuracy (±18 µm/300 mm), with C3 (±12 µm/300 mm) and C1 (±6 µm/300 mm) available for high‑precision applications. Ground thread screws with double nuts provide zero‑backlash preload for CNC and metrology systems.
Do you offer custom length linear guides and ball screws?
Yes. Linear guide rails can be supplied in continuous lengths up to 4,000 mm, with butt‑jointed longer assemblies available. Ball screws are manufactured to custom overall length, thread length, and end machining specifications per customer drawings.
